Project Overview

The Centre for Addiction and Mental Health (CAMH) is Canada’s largest mental health teaching hospital and one of the world’s leading research centres in its field. BGO's employee Resource Groups (ERGs), accessible to all employees across the globe, and the People & Talent Team, partnered with CAMH to host the Mental Health Awareness Month.

I spearheaded the design of a series of emails that invited employees to participate in learning sessions and activities.

Approach
  • Collaborated with People and Talent team gathering content and requirements

  • Conceptualized and designed emails, posters, screen wallpaper, and bingo card that incorporated the "Sunrise Challenge" colors

Results:
  • Designs inspired action and drove employee engagement

  • Fostered a sense of community

  • Final emails were integrated with Marketo for distribution
